The domain musicfromhell.nl is your domain, right? The SPF of that domain is "v=spf1 mx a ~all" which should be ok when your IP is 185.10.48.237
I think, your problem is "Please contact your Internet service provider since part of their network is on our block list (S3140)".
We were getting this for one server, you need to get Microsoft to mitigate the issue by filling out the form at this url :- https://support.microsoft.com/en-us...-us&forceorigin=esmc&ccsid=636642930708442746 They will then investigate and mitigate if your domain is valid. A pain but it happens.
Forgot to say we also for the affected domain set a specific SPF for the valid IP addresses v=spf1 mx a include:ns1.domain.name include:ns2.domain.name ip4:A.B.C.D ip4:A.B.C.D -all
